Programme Overview
The Professional Certificate in Graph Mining for Biological Data Analysis is a comprehensive program designed for biologists, data scientists, and researchers seeking to harness the power of graph mining techniques to analyze complex biological networks and data. This program equips learners with the essential knowledge and skills to understand and manipulate biological data through a graph-based approach, which is crucial for advancing research in genomics, proteomics, and other life sciences.
Participants will develop a deep understanding of graph theory, including how to represent biological data as graphs and analyze these graphs using advanced algorithms. They will learn to apply graph mining techniques such as community detection, node and edge prediction, and graph kernel methods to extract meaningful insights from large, complex biological datasets. Additionally, learners will gain proficiency in using specialized software and tools, such as NetworkX, igraph, and Cytoscape, to model and visualize biological networks.
